HEIC at a glance

HEIC

HEIC became widely recognized when Apple adopted HEIF-based image storage in its consumer ecosystem, turning a standards-driven container family into an everyday format users actually encountered.

ICNS at a glance

ICNS

ICNS reflects the Mac graphics-resource tradition where a single icon asset is really a packaged set of representations for one application or object identity.

FAQs

Why convert HEIC to ICNS?

Choose ICNS as target when creating or updating macOS application icons or preserving Apple-specific icon assets.

What changes when converting HEIC to ICNS?

Convert to ICNS when creating or updating macOS application icons or preserving Apple-specific icon assets. It is the correct target when a Mac application bundle or desktop asset workflow expects native icon resources.
